Patio Slab Repair in Des Moines, IA

Patio slab rep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the integrity of existing concrete patios. These repairs typically address issues such as cracking, sinking, uneven surfaces, or surface deterioration caused by weather, ground movement, or age. Projects may include filling cracks, leveling uneven slabs, replacing damaged sections, or addressing underlying soil problems to ensure a safe and stable outdoor space. Homeowners often seek these services to improve the appearance of their patios, prevent further damage, and extend the lifespan of their outdoor living areas.

Before requesting patio slab repairs,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age and whether repairs will be sufficient or if a full replacement is necessary. It’s important to consider the age of the existing concrete, the causes of the damage, and the overall condition of the slabs. Clear communication about the specific issues and desired outcomes can help determine the most effective repair approach. Proper assessment can also identify underlying soil or drainage problems that may need addressing to prevent future issues.

Common Patio Slab Repair Jobs

Patio Slab Repair - addresses cracked or uneven slabs to restore safety and appearance.

Crack Filling - involves sealing existing cracks to prevent further damage and water infiltration.

Slab Leveling - corrects sinking or settling slabs to improve stability and prevent tripping hazards.

Surface Resurfacing - refreshes worn or stained patio surfaces for a renewed look.

Damage Restoration - repairs chips, holes, or other surface damages to extend the life of the patio.

Joint Repair - restores or replaces deteriorated joints to maintain proper slab alignment and drainage.

Patio Slab Repair Questions

What causes patio slabs to crack or settle? Common causes include soil movement, freeze-thaw cycles, and heavy loads that put stress on the slabs.

How can damaged patio slabs be repaired? Repairs often involve lifting and replacing broken or sunken slabs, or adding a new layer of base material for stabilization.

Is it possible to prevent future damage to patio slabs? Proper drainage, regular maintenance, and avoiding heavy impacts can help reduce the risk of damage over time.

What signs indicate that patio slabs need repair? Visible cracking, uneven surfaces, and loose or shifting slabs are common indicators that repairs are needed.
